A second later, the phrase ‘a wrinkle in time’ also slipped in. That phrase was the actual title of a science fantasy novel by Madeleine L ’Engle, completed in 1960.
I read this book some years ago and loved it!
It was rejected by twenty-six publishers as being too different. First, it featured a female protagonist, unusual in that day, and secondly, it was considered “too overtly evil for young people”. Questions arose whether it should be classified for young readers or adult readers. L ‘Engle was disappointed when it was finally classified as young adult science fantasy.
🌟In 1962, that book, A Wrinkle in Time, won the Newbury Medal, the Sequoyah Book Award, the Lewis Carrol Shelf Award, and was runner-up for the Hans Christian Anderson Award. It inspired films, and a theatrical film produced by the Walt Disney Company.
As of 2025, A Wrinkle in Time has sold over ten million copies.

Back on planet Earth, September 7th is the Full Corn Moon 🌕. According to natives of the northeastern United States, September is the month of peak production, when farmers can work late into the night by the light of this bright Moon. Corn, pumpkins, squash, beans and wild rice are the staples ready for gathering which will supply them food through the long winter months.
In the mid-Atlantic seaboard, the Cherokee name for this moon is the Full Nut Moon when chestnuts, hazelnuts, acorns, and pecans are gathered.
Japan celebrates this month through Tsukimi, which means ‘moon viewing’. They honor and appreciate the beauty of the brilliant Autumn moon in the clear night sky from the comfort of their homes or in outdoor settings.
Also on September 7th, we will experience the Full Moon at 15° degrees of Pisces, which will be a Total Lunar Eclipse. 🌑
A total Lunar Eclipse is when the Earth comes between the Sun and the Moon. blocking the Sun’s light from reaching the Moon. Because the Moon appears reddish due to the scattering of sunlight by the Earth’s atmosphere, it’s called a Blood Moon. A Total Eclipse, of course, is when the Moon falls totally within the Earth’s shadow. 🌑

Perhaps you’ll come up with a brilliant idea like twelve-year-old Rebecca Young from Glasgow whose face appears on Time Magazine’s latest issue “Girls Of The Year”. Rebecca entered the UK Primary Engineer Competition and out of 70,000 entrants won first prize for her solar powered blanket which she invented to help the homeless people she saw on the streets stay warm during Glascow’s 20° below zero nights.
Her notes and diagrams for this invention, handwritten in a school notebook, look almost like doodles, some in balloons and in cartoon like sketches, and other scribbled notes that often occur when one is thinking. Rebecca Young also plays drums. You can find her on YouTube pounding the drum skin.
